Google Map API中文使用說明如下:(詳見js/fGMap.js文件)
方法以及相關(guān)參數(shù)說明:
(1)GBrowserIsCompatible() -- 是否支持Google Map API
(2)myLat – 目標(biāo)位置的經(jīng)度坐標(biāo),
(3)myLng – 目標(biāo)位置的緯度坐標(biāo)
(4)new GLatLng(myLat, myLng) -- 設(shè)置經(jīng)緯度
(5)map.setCenter(new GLatLng(myLat, myLng), 14) -- 設(shè)置地圖默認(rèn)的中心點(diǎn)經(jīng)緯度
(6)new GLatLng(myLat, myLng) -- 設(shè)置中心點(diǎn)的經(jīng)緯度
(7)14 -- 地圖的默認(rèn)縮放比例大小值,范圍為1 - 18
(8)new GMap2(document.getElementById("GoogleMap")) -- 獲取顯示的地圖容器
(9)map.setMapType(G_NORMAL_MAP); -- 設(shè)置顯示地圖的類型
可選值:
a. G_NORMAL_MAP -- 默認(rèn)地圖樣式
b. G_SATELLITE_MAP -- Google Earth衛(wèi)星地圖
c. G_HYBRID_MAP -- 混合模式地圖
(10)new GIcon(G_DEFAULT_ICON) -- 設(shè)置標(biāo)記樣式
(11)addControl() -- 給地圖添加控件
常用的可選控件:
a. new GLargeMapControl() -- 大的地圖縮放級(jí)別控件
b. new GOverviewMapControl() -- 地圖縮略圖控件
c. new GScaleControl() -- 比例尺控件
d. new GMapTypeControl() -- 地圖類形選擇控件
(12)enableDoubleClickZoom() -- 雙擊(鼠標(biāo)右鍵)放大/(鼠標(biāo)左鍵)縮小地圖比例
(13)map.enableScrollWheelZoom() -- 滾動(dòng)滑輪方法(向前)放大/(向后)縮小地圖比例
(14)enableContinuousZoom() -- 允許連貫改變地圖比例
(15)createMarker(latlng) -- 自定義方法
(16)new GMarker(latlng) -- 在地圖中設(shè)置標(biāo)簽,參數(shù)latlng -- 標(biāo)簽的坐標(biāo)
(17)Event.addListener(marker,event,function) -- 給標(biāo)簽設(shè)置事件
marker -- 標(biāo)簽對(duì)象,
event -- 事件名稱
function -- 時(shí)間的處理函數(shù)
(18)openInfoWindowHtml(latlng, myHtml) -- 將信息框添加到標(biāo)簽上
latlng -- 標(biāo)簽坐標(biāo),
myHtml -- 提示信息的HTML字符串
(19)獲取地圖中心坐標(biāo):
javascript:void(prompt('中心坐標(biāo)',gApplication.getMap().getCenter()));
通過以上說明我們可以通過實(shí)例MyApp1.html來改變我們的方法或者參數(shù)。聯(lián)系客服